Ordinals
beta
Address 36FZYiQTb3C7eEHTeWBEeTdmLgZmSbN5ua
sat balance
29149
runes balances
outputs
818c6b5771be7bda7880b105db577ae196edda619cb18a988f4758a4be8abb5a:1